Moscows, Aug. 1 -- Due to the growth of bilateral cargo flows to and from Laos, Russia intends to expand sea transportation through the ports of Vietnam and open a railway connection through China.

Russian President Vladimir Putin announced this on July 31 following his talks with Lao President Thongloun Sisoulith.

In 2024, Laos-Russia trade increased by 66%, and by another 20% for the first five months of 2025. The establishment of new transport routes is expected to facilitate the transportation of goods between the two countries.
